Course Structure and Overview
The Oxford IB Diploma Program Chemistry Course Companion is structured to cater to the diverse needs of IB students. The course is divided into several main units that cover the core topics mandated by the IB syllabus as well as additional options that allow for deeper exploration of specific areas of chemistry.
Core Topics
The core topics covered in the IB Chemistry curriculum include:
1. Stoichiometric Relationships
- Understanding the mole concept and its application in calculations.
- Balancing chemical equations and performing stoichiometric calculations.
2. Atomic Structure
- Exploring the structure of atoms, isotopes, and ions.
- Discussing models of atomic structure, including quantum mechanics.
3. Periodic Table Trends
- Investigating the organization of the periodic table.
- Analyzing trends in atomic radius, electronegativity, and ionization energy.
4. Chemical Bonding and Molecular Structure
- Types of bonding: ionic, covalent, and metallic.
- VSEPR theory and molecular geometry.
5. Thermodynamics
- Understanding energy changes in chemical reactions.
- The laws of thermodynamics and their applications in chemistry.
6. Kinetics
- Factors affecting reaction rates.
- The role of catalysts and the concept of activation energy.
7. Equilibrium
- The dynamic nature of chemical equilibrium.
- Le Chatelier's principle and its applications.
8. Acids and Bases
- Theories of acids and bases (Arrhenius, Bronsted-Lowry, Lewis).
- pH calculations and titration techniques.
9. Redox Processes
- Oxidation and reduction reactions.
- Balancing redox equations and applications in electrochemistry.
10. Organic Chemistry
- Basic principles of organic chemistry, including functional groups and reactions.
- Understanding isomerism, nomenclature, and reaction mechanisms.
Additional Options
In addition to the core topics, students can choose from various optional topics that allow for tailored learning experiences. Some of these options include:
- Biochemistry: The study of chemical processes within and relating to living organisms.
- Materials: Understanding the properties and applications of materials in chemistry.
- Medicinal Chemistry: The design and development of pharmaceutical compounds.
- Environmental Chemistry: Exploring chemical processes in the environment and their impact on ecosystems.
Practical Component of the Course
The practical component of the IB Chemistry course is critical for reinforcing theoretical knowledge through hands-on experience. The Oxford IB Diploma Program Chemistry Course Companion emphasizes the importance of practical work and includes guidelines for conducting experiments.
Laboratory Work
Students are expected to complete a series of laboratory experiments that align with the theoretical concepts studied in class. The course companion provides:
- Detailed Experiment Protocols: Step-by-step guides for conducting experiments safely and effectively, including the necessary materials and safety precautions.
- Data Collection and Analysis: Techniques for collecting and interpreting data, including the use of graphs and statistical analysis.
- Report Writing: Guidance on how to write scientific reports, including structure, content, and referencing.
Internal Assessment (IA)
The Internal Assessment is a significant component of the IB Chemistry course, accounting for 20% of the final grade. The course companion assists students in:
- Choosing a Topic: Suggestions for selecting a suitable research question based on personal interest and feasibility.
- Conducting Research: Encouragement to engage in independent research, including literature reviews.
- Evaluating Results: Strategies for interpreting experimental data and considering limitations and improvements.
